Developing Countries are Depending on Economic Globalization to Achieve First-World Standard of Living

Usha C. V. Haley, George T. Haley and David M. Boje

Chapter 7 in Storytelling in the Global Age:There is No Planet B, 2019, pp 125-129 from World Scientific Publishing Co. Pte. Ltd.

Abstract: Narrative 7: Globalization introduced a radical change in world economy in the 1980s with China, and 1990s with Soviet bloc and India (Bourguignon, 2017: 75). The result is that 1 billion workers, mostly unskilled, entered, which resulted in increased international trade (Hecksher-Ohlin model) with Southern countries exploring unskilled labor to North with technology-intensive goods (Bourguignon, 2017)…
